All Categories
Featured
Table of Contents
Simply put, companies looking for technical candidates desire to learn what a candidate can do prior to they learn that they are. Among one of the most crucial characteristics prospects should show is demonstrable coding skill. Organizations working with for technological duties intend to see that you can analyze a trouble, craft a response and review/test your code.
The technological sector is one-of-a-kind because successful interviewing requires having certain, customized knowledge (coding interview bootcamp). Organizations commonly analyze this knowledge at the initial stage of the meeting process, saving inquiries regarding your passions, character and experience for future rounds. A technical assessment usually takes either forms: a timed, self-directed examination or a live coding session with a recruiter
In several subsequent meetings, the interviewer(s) will ask concerns that better evaluate just how your personality and passions align with the company. Slow down and analyze the inquiry initially, as there may be multiple actions to comply with or certain details to make up. Construct in a procedure for evaluating your code.
A proficient designer understands they need to examine their work. There's most likely something you do not recognize or info in a meeting motivate may be missing or misinforming. Program your interviewer that you are sharp and curious by asking questions. Do not sit in silence and panic if you're confronted with unknown content.
, a website including comprehensive information on what it's really like to work within a market, company or career.
We'll begin by covering what a technological meeting involves. We'll get into what you can anticipate during a technological meeting in each stage of the process and what you can do to stand out.
And we'll wrap up with ideas on preparing for a technical interview (plus what not to do). Inside, you'll likewise find coding interview tips and recommendations from technical meeting specialists who have actually gone via the procedure themselves AND performed technology interviews from the other end of the table. Their first-hand understanding will educate you exactly how to plan for a technological meeting with real-world considerations in mind.
, plus some virtual technical meeting ideas for success. Unlike various other kinds of job meetings, technology task meetings entail obstacles and tasks. They're extra like an examination than a regular question-and-answer meeting.
A first technological screening interview typically lasts 15-30 minutes. Some firms will certainly wish to test your coding abilities with an initial test before having you actually come in. It may be performed over the phone, via Skype or Zoom, or as a homework-type assignment via an internet application or email.
This is the phase that the majority of people call the real "technological meeting." It entails an in-person interview with coding difficulties you have to complete on a white boards in front of the recruiter(s). Technology meetings at this stage can additionally be done from another location over video meeting if the firm is remote.
As I stated previously, though, every firm's tech meeting process is various. Below are a couple of instances of exactly how some prominent technology firms arrange their technological meeting stages:: first phone or Google Hangout meeting (30-60 minutes); onsite tech interview (4 hours composed of 4 different interviews): First technological screening meeting (30-50 min); onsite interview (1 complete day): preliminary phone display (30-60 min); in-person meeting (1 full day comprised of 6 back-to-back personal and technological interviews) Exactly how to plan for a software developer interview likewise depends upon the seniority of the function you're applying fore.g.
To discover more regarding what the firm you're interviewing with could ask you, or even more about their technical interview process, do a little study. Examine to see if the company has a technology blog site. Sometimes companies devote entire blog write-ups to their tech interview process and what to anticipate (here's an example from a company called Asana).
This responses might be concerning traditional or technical meetings, and some individuals may also share what kinds of coding interview questions they were asked. If you're still coming up short, fire the employer or working with supervisor a fast email asking what the meeting process will certainly look like.
Obviously, this is one more variable that will certainly differ from business to business, yet you'll normally be looking at either scenarios based upon business size:: participant(s) of the engineering group, a senior developer, and even the CTO. All recruiters typically have technological experience and may be your future managers or colleagues.
It can reduce your meeting anxiety to place a face to a name, plus you could discover something you can connect over (you went to the exact same college, you have similar rate of interests, or something like that to start the ball rolling). For much more on using LinkedIn to obtain a means of access, take a look at this guide to obtaining work referrals even as a technology rookie.
Various other business may concentrate extra on real-world troubles that look like everyday operate at the company. Allow's look briefly at several of the types and topics of programmer interview inquiries you may come across throughout a technological interview. For a complete failure, see my overview to technological meeting concerns. A versatile software application designer meeting will consist of questions that refer to a candidate's difficult and soft skills.
These inquiries refer to how you've acted in a details circumstance in the past. These are based on actual life circumstances you have actually encountered. Instances include: Inform me concerning a time when you took care of a challenging situation. Provide me an example of a time when you worked successfully under pressure. What took place when you slipped up at the office? These interview concerns deal with hypothetical circumstances in the future and what you may perform in that details circumstance.
Technical meeting concerns that examine your genuine abilities and knowledge is the heart of the technology meeting. These can be tech-oriented trivia-type concerns like: Just how can you ensure that your code is both secure and rapid? When do you make use of polymorphism? Explain the distinction in between a variety and a linked list.
That's because what a lot of business wish to know, extra so than what realities you've remembered, is exactly how well you can solve troubles. As we have actually noted, there are not really any kind of "typical" technical interview questions when it comes to specifics. Nevertheless, there are a few common styles and subjects of coding interview questions that often appear in technological interviews throughout different industries: Data frameworks Algorithms Databases System style Networking Problem-solving For more on this, look into my guide to usual technological meeting inquiries.
Table of Contents
Latest Posts
What Is The Best Roadmap For Coding Interview Preparation?
What Is The Best Way To Prepare For Technical Coaching?
What Are The Most Effective Tools For Job Interview Coding Practice?
More
Latest Posts
What Is The Best Roadmap For Coding Interview Preparation?
What Is The Best Way To Prepare For Technical Coaching?
What Are The Most Effective Tools For Job Interview Coding Practice?